Outline of Final Research Achievements |
Sarcopenia is an aging-related debilitating condition which is characterized by progressive loss of skeletal muscle mass and strength. The mechanism of sarcopenia is not elucidated and the treatment has not been established. We examined the involvement of inflammation in inducing muscle atrophy and how this involvement was affected by HMB (a metabolite of leucine), vitamin D and TJ-41 (a traditional herbal medicine). In tail suspended mice, which is a mouse model bearing muscle atrophy, HMB and vitamin D inhibited muscle atrophy, expression of atrophy-related genes, and elevation of the serum interleukin-6 level. TJ-41 ameliorated reactive oxygen-induced damage in myoblasts by inhibiting inflammation. We conclude that anti-inflammatory effects of HMB, vitamin D and TJ-41 might be therapeutic to sarcopenia.
